Alcohol and Drug Addiction Treatment at a Valium Rehab
Valium rehab programs focus on helping individuals safely reduce dependence on a long-acting benzodiazepine that affects the central nervous system. While Valium is often prescribed for anxiety disorders, severe anxiety, and muscle spasms, ongoing Valium use can lead to physical dependence and increased risk of serious complications. Valium addiction and other addictions we treat can develop gradually, especially when prescriptions extend over time or when doses increase. The calming effects that initially provide relief can lead to reliance, making it difficult to function without the medication. Over time, individuals may need more Valium to feel the same effects, which increases the risk of life-threatening outcomes.
